New vs. Used Freightliner Trucks in OKC:
The choice between a new and used Freightliner is often one of the first decisions buyers face. Both options present distinct benefits and drawbacks that warrant careful consideration.
-
New Freightliner Trucks Oklahoma City:
Purchasing a new Freightliner offers the latest technology, maximum fuel efficiency, and the peace of mind that comes with a full manufacturer’s warranty. You’ll benefit from cutting-edge safety features, advanced telematics, and often, more favorable financing rates. The main drawback, of course, is the higher initial investment. New trucks are ideal for businesses looking for long-term fleet solutions and predictable operating costs.
-
Used Freightliner Trucks OKC:
For many owner-operators and smaller fleets, a used Freightliner represents a highly cost-effective entry point into the market. You can acquire a reliable, proven truck at a significantly lower price point, allowing for quicker return on investment. The availability of diverse models and configurations in the used market is also a major plus. However, careful inspection and a thorough understanding of the truck’s history are absolutely essential to mitigate potential risks associated with wear and tear.
Key Factors to Consider When Buying a Freightliner in OKC:
Regardless of whether you choose new or used, several critical factors should guide your purchasing decision. Overlooking any of these can lead to costly mistakes down the road.
-
Budget and Financing Options:
Before you even start looking, establish a clear budget. This includes not just the purchase price, but also insurance, registration, and initial maintenance costs. Explore various truck financing OKC options, including traditional loans, leases, and lines of credit. Getting pre-approved for financing can significantly streamline the buying process and give you stronger negotiating power. -
Truck Type and Application:
Your operational needs dictate the type of Freightliner you require. Are you an over-the-road (OTR) driver needing a spacious sleeper and robust engine? Or do you primarily perform regional hauls, requiring a day cab? Perhaps you need a vocational truck for specific jobs. Clearly defining your primary application will narrow down your choices considerably. -
Condition and Professional Inspection:
This is paramount, especially for used trucks. Pro tips from us: Always arrange for a pre-purchase inspection by an independent, certified mechanic specializing in heavy-duty trucks. They can identify potential issues that might not be obvious to the untrained eye, saving you from significant repair costs later. Don’t skip this crucial step, even if the seller seems trustworthy. -
Mileage and Engine Hours:
For used Freightliners, mileage and engine hours provide critical insights into the vehicle’s past life. While high mileage isn’t necessarily a deal-breaker for a well-maintained Freightliner, it should influence your negotiation and inspection focus. Balance these figures with the truck’s overall condition and service history. -
Comprehensive Maintenance Records:
A truck with a complete and verifiable maintenance history is invaluable. These records demonstrate how well the truck has been cared for and can highlight any recurring issues or major repairs. Insist on seeing these records; a seller unwilling to provide them should raise a red flag. -
Warranty Options:
New Freightliner trucks come with comprehensive factory warranties. For used trucks, inquire about any remaining factory warranty or extended warranty options offered by the dealership. A good warranty can provide peace of mind and protect against unexpected repair expenses. -
Dealer Reputation and Support:
Whether buying new or used, the reputation of the seller matters. Research dealerships, read reviews, and ask for references. A reputable dealer will offer transparent pricing, excellent customer service, and robust after-sales support, including parts and service departments.

The Buying Process: A Step-by-Step Guide for OKC Buyers
Purchasing a Freightliner truck is a significant investment. Following a structured process can help ensure a smooth, transparent, and ultimately successful transaction.
-
Step 1: Define Your Needs and Budget:
Before anything else, clearly outline what you need the truck for (e.g., long-haul, local delivery, specialized work). Determine your maximum budget, including the down payment, monthly payments, and operational costs. This will narrow your search considerably. -
Step 2: Research and Locate Potential Trucks:
Utilize the resources mentioned above—authorized dealers, independent lots, and online marketplaces—to identify Freightliner trucks that match your criteria. Create a shortlist of promising candidates. -
Step 3: Thorough Inspection and Test Drive:
Once you have a few trucks in mind, schedule visits. Perform a detailed visual inspection of the interior and exterior. Check for rust, fluid leaks, tire wear, and cabin condition. Crucially, arrange for that independent mechanic’s inspection, especially for used models. A comprehensive test drive is also non-negotiable; pay attention to engine performance, transmission shifting, braking, and overall handling. -
Step 4: Review Documentation & History (VIN Check):
For any used truck, obtain the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). Use it to run a comprehensive history report (e.g., through services like Carfax for commercial vehicles or similar industry-specific databases). This report can reveal accident history, previous ownership, odometer discrepancies, and salvage titles. Also, verify the title is clear and transferable. Step 5: Secure Financing (if needed):
If you haven’t already, finalize your financing arrangements. Have all necessary documents ready, such as business plans, financial statements, and personal credit history. -
Step 6: Negotiate the Price:
Armed with your inspection report and market research, be prepared to negotiate. Don’t be afraid to walk away if the terms aren’t favorable. Remember that the initial asking price is rarely the final price. -
Step 7: Finalize the Purchase & Paperwork:
Once you agree on a price, carefully review all sales contracts and paperwork before signing. Ensure all agreements, including warranties, are in writing. Understand the terms of the sale, including payment schedules, title transfer, and any applicable taxes or fees.Pro tips: Never rush through the paperwork. Take your time, read every clause, and ask questions about anything unclear. It’s always a good idea to have a legal professional review contracts for significant purchases.

DOT Regulations and Compliance in Oklahoma:
Operating a commercial truck involves adhering to federal and state regulations. Familiarize yourself with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) rules and specific Oklahoma Department of Transportation (ODOT) requirements. This includes aspects like Hours of Service (HOS), weight limits, and necessary permits. Non-compliance can lead to hefty fines and operational disruptions.
Insurance Considerations:
Secure appropriate commercial truck insurance before hitting the road. This typically includes liability, physical damage, cargo, and often, non-trucking liability (bobtail) insurance. Work with an insurance broker specializing in commercial trucking to ensure you have adequate coverage for your operations in Oklahoma City and beyond.
